Université Paris-Saclay has once again strengthened its position among the world’s leading universities, ranking 13th globally and 1st in France in the 2026 Academic Ranking of World Universities (ARWU), widely known as the Shanghai Ranking.
This remarkable achievement places Université Paris-Saclay at the forefront of French higher education and among the leading European universities in one of the world’s most recognized international university rankings. The result reflects the University’s sustained excellence in research, academic performance and international scientific impact.
Outstanding Global Performance in Fundamental Sciences
- 2nd worldwide in Mathematics
- 6th worldwide in Physics

A Strategic Academic Partnership with University Metropolitan Tirana
As part of this collaboration, UMT doctoral researcher Geraldo Liçi is pursuing his PhD under an international cotutelle agreement with Université Paris-Saclay, within the Doctoral School of Information and Communication Sciences and Technologies (ED STIC). Through the cotutelle framework, the doctoral research brings together the academic expertise, supervision and research environments of both institutions, providing the researcher with an international doctoral experience and access to the wider Paris-Saclay research ecosystem.
